Understanding Mitsubishi Keys
Mitsubishi Galant Key Fob vehicles use different types of keys, including conventional metal keys, transponder keys, and clever keys. Here is a breakdown of these key types:
Key TypeDescriptionFeaturesConventional KeyAn easy cut metal key utilized in older modelsNo electronic featuresTransponder KeyConsists of a chip that communicates with the car's ignition systemRequires programming to start the automobileSmart KeyA key fob that enables keyless entry and ignitionProximity sensing units and advanced functionsTypes of Mitsubishi Keys
Traditional Keys
Typically discovered in older Mitsubishi models like the Mitsubishi Galant or Eclipse.Easy to duplicate from the original key.
Transponder Keys
Presented in the early 2000s, these keys have a small chip embedded in them.They provide enhanced security since the car will not start unless the proper key exists.
Smart Keys
Readily available in newer models such as the Mitsubishi Key Fobs Outlander and Eclipse Cross.Offer benefit features like unlocking the doors without utilizing the key and beginning the engine with the button press.The Replacement Process
The process of changing Mitsubishi keys may differ depending upon the key type. Below are the steps included for each type:
1. Conventional Key ReplacementAction 1: Visit a locksmith or hardware shop.Step 2: Provide the original key or the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N).Action 3: The locksmith professional will cut a brand-new key utilizing a key-cutting maker.Step 4: Test the brand-new key to ensure it works effectively.
Cost: Typically varies from ₤ 5 to ₤ 50, depending upon the locksmith professional and geographic area.
2. Transponder Key ReplacementAction 1: Locate a certified locksmith professional or a Mitsubishi Keys Replacement dealership.Action 2: Provide the original transponder key if readily available or the lorry VIN.Action 3: The locksmith professional will cut the new key and program the transponder chip to match the car's ignition system.Step 4: After programming, test the key to guarantee functionality.
Cost: Usually falls between ₤ 100 to ₤ 250.
3. Smart Key ReplacementAction 1: Contact a Mitsubishi Fast Key dealer or an automotive locksmith with the ability to deal with wise keys.Step 2: Present the automobile recognition files and keyless entry system details.Step 3: The dealer or locksmith professional will cut and program the new smart key utilizing customized devices.Step 4: Test the key for both keyless entry and starting performance.
Cost: Normally varies from ₤ 200 to ₤ 400.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Can I replace my Mitsubishi key myself?
While some may try to replace a standard key by checking out a hardware shop, modern-day keys like transponders and wise keys need customized devices to cut and program. It is recommended to look for expert help to ensure appropriate performance.
2. How long does it take to replace a Mitsubishi key?Conventional Key: Usually takes 10-20 minutes at a locksmith professional.Transponder Key: Can take 30-60 minutes depending upon shows.Smart Key: A replacement can take anywhere from 30 minutes to a few hours, particularly if it requires multiple key programs.3. What should I do if my key is lost?
If your key is lost, it's crucial to act rapidly. Consider the following actions:
Check if you have a spare key.Contact a locksmith or car dealership with your VIN to initiate the key replacement procedure.Think about having your car's ignition system rekeyed for security functions if you fear unauthorized gain access to.4. Exist any techniques to prevent losing my keys?
To lessen the risk of losing keys, think about these methods:
Use a keychain with a tracking gadget (such as Apple AirTag or Tile).Designate a specific area in your home for holding keys.Set pointers to look for keys before leaving any area.5. Does car insurance cover key replacement?
Some insurance coverage may cover key replacement under particular scenarios, such as theft. It's suggested to inspect your policy details or speak with your insurance coverage agent for clarification.
